LAZY E 14

LAZY E 14 is a Texas oil lease in Glasscock County, Railroad Commission district 08, operated by Laredo Petroleum, Inc. It has 1 wellbore on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from October 2011 to March 2020, totalling 37,410 barrels. The lease is not currently producing. Its strongest month on the record we hold was January 2012, at 3,557 barrels.
